Jim Carrey received applause from prominent figures in French cinema at the 51st edition of the French Cesar Awards, where the Canadian actor received an honorary award and delivered a touching speech in French. Jim Carrey, the star of THE MASK and HOW THE GRINCH STOLE CHRISTMAS, was awarded a prize specifically given to international stars, like Julia Roberts last year.
He was introduced on stage by Michel Gondry, who directed him in ETERNAL SUNSHINE OF THE SPOTLESS MIND 22 years ago. "As an actor, every character you play is like clay in the hands of a sculptor, which you shape according to the desires of your heart," Jim Carrey said in French with a strong American accent, as reported by variety.com. "How lucky I am to share this art with so many people who truly open their hearts to me," he continued.
